There is no concept of postponement or exceeding the time limit for motor vehicle annual inspections. No matter how many days past the deadline, it is considered illegal. However, it depends on the situation. If it is only overdue within the month of the inspection date, generally there is no issue and you can participate in the annual inspection normally. If it exceeds one month past the inspection date, it is considered an illegal act of missing the inspection. Consequences of overdue annual inspection penalties: 1. Relevant regulations: According to the regulations, if a vehicle does not undergo the annual inspection within the specified time, the public security authorities will impose a warning and a fine of 200 yuan. If caught by traffic police on the road, a fine of 200 yuan and 3 demerit points will be imposed. 2. Insurance companies will not compensate: If a car does not undergo the annual inspection on time and is involved in a traffic accident during operation, the party involved will bear full responsibility, and the insurance company will not provide compensation. 3. Forced scrapping: If a car does not undergo safety technical inspections for three consecutive years and fails to obtain the motor vehicle inspection qualification mark, it will be subject to forced scrapping.
